Nth Degree Stylemakers
A reception was held in early November at Bertrand at Mister A’s to celebrate San Diego’s top ten best-dressed women and ten best-dressed men as selected by Fashion Forward’s Leonard Simpson. Honorees met and mingled while enjoying cocktails and hors d’oeuvres al fresco overlooking twinkling downtown San Diego. The 20 stylemakers (featured here) were then honored at Mercy Hospital Auxiliary’s inaugural Dressed to the Nth Degree runway fashion show and luncheon at the US Grant Hotel in mid-November. Chaired by Linda Masters, with Merle Lotherington as co-chair and Sally B. Thornton serving as honorary chair, the event also featured a Champagne reception, boutique shopping, and silent auction, with proceeds benefiting the hospital’s Robotic Surgery Department.

Sweater Girl
Cameron Diaz has a baby blue cardigan decorated with blue topaz, Fergie favors pink with rose quartz, and music producer Quincy Jones sports smoky quartz on his cable vest. The bejeweled cashmere collection is the work of Rancho Santa Fe’s Lena Evans, who launched Jade Phoenix Designs during New York Fashion Week. The former entertainment industry executive was frustrated by cheap buttons often found on luxurious cashmere. "I was at a jewelry shop with a girlfriend and it was one those light bulb moments," Evans recalls. "I said, ’What if we put jewels on the sweaters?’ That’s how it was born." The soft-as-a-cloud cashmeres come in an array of colors and styles from a demure pink pullover with pearls to a sexy little black number with shoulder cut-outs and garnets. There are tiny sweaters for babies, and "birthday sweaters" adorned with birthstones. The Saigon-born Evans called her line Jade Phoenix after her Vietnamese name. Attached to each sweater is a jade coin, symbolizing health and wealth. Prices range from $250 to $2,000. (www.jadephoenixdesigns.com) — Andrea Naversen
